Generic Name : Riluzole
Pronunciation : ril' yoo zole
Therapeutic Classification : Central Nervous System Agents

Brand Names or Trade Names of Riluzole

International :


Rilutek

Why is Riluzole Prescribed? (Indications)

This medication is a benzothiazole, recommended for am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S, Lou Gehrig disease) is placed on a ventilator or breathing machine, by delaying onset of ventilator dependence or tracheostomy. It may prevent further damage to certain brain cells.

When should Riluzole not be taken? (Contraindications)

Hypersensitivity.

What is the dosage of Riluzole?

The recommended dose is 50 mg orally every 12 hours.

How should Riluzole be taken?

This medication available in the form of tablet to take by mouth, twice a day, every 12 hours.

What are the warnings and precautions for Riluzole?

•Caution should be exercised in patients with history of allergies, blood disorders or anemia or kidney or liver disease, pregnant, plan to become pregnant and breastfeeding.

Cigarette smoking may decrease the effectiveness of this drug.

What are the side effects of Riluzole?

Central Nervous System- Dizziness, depression.
Gastrointestinal- Upset stomach, diarrhea, loss of appetite.
Miscellaneous- Tiredness, muscle weakness, difficulty in breathing, fever.

What are the other precautions for Riluzole?

To avoid liver damage, do not drink alcoholic beverages.

What are the storage conditions for Riluzole?

Store at 25°C. Store it in an airtight container.
